2006 Honda Accord vs. 1994 Jeep Cherokee

To start off, 2006 Honda Accord is newer by 12 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1994 Jeep Cherokee.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1994 Jeep Cherokee would be higher. At 3,960 cc (6 cylinders), 1994 Jeep Cherokee is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Honda Accord (188 HP @ 6800 RPM) has 6 more horse power than 1994 Jeep Cherokee. (182 HP @ 4600 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2006 Honda Accord should accelerate faster than 1994 Jeep Cherokee.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2006 Honda Accord weights approximately 18 kg more than 1994 Jeep Cherokee.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1994 Jeep Cherokee is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2006 Honda Accord.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1994 Jeep Cherokee will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1994 Jeep Cherokee (301 Nm @ 2400 RPM) has 78 more torque (in Nm) than 2006 Honda Accord. (223 Nm @ 4500 RPM). This means 1994 Jeep Cherokee will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2006 Honda Accord.

Compare all specifications:

2006 Honda Accord 1994 Jeep Cherokee
Make Honda Jeep
Model Accord Cherokee
Year Released 2006 1994
Body Type Sedan SUV
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2354 cc 3960 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 188 HP 182 HP
Engine RPM 6800 RPM 4600 RPM
Torque 223 Nm 301 Nm
Torque RPM 4500 RPM 2400 RPM
Engine Bore Size 87 mm 98.6 mm
Engine Stroke Size 99 mm 86.6 mm
Fuel Type Gasoline - Premium Gasoline
Drive Type Front 4WD
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 1578 kg 1560 kg
Vehicle Length 4760 mm 4300 mm
Vehicle Width 1770 mm 1800 mm
Vehicle Height 1480 mm 1630 mm
Wheelbase Size 2730 mm 2580 mm
